Key differences between traditional privacy narratives vs FHE narratives
Most privacy technologies rely on 'proving you didn't peek', but cannot achieve 'computation without peeking'.
The core breakthrough of FHE is:
Even the model doesn't know what your data is, but it can still calculate the correct answer.
